Abstract: | In the theory of teaching, the problem of interrelation between two types of cognition — the scientific and the educational — has been discussed for a long time. The author of this paper has come to the conclusion that logic of an educational subject does not unambiguously follow from the logic of science (paradigm). The same content of the course can be realized with the help of several isomorphous structures of equal value and consistent with the existing logic of science. The choice of structure is determined by educational aims, types of education institutions, periods of studies, the presence of connections between subjects and other conditions. |
